      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;We've had PAN kit for the best part of a year and use it for SSL decryption among other things.&amp;nbsp; &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The SSL certs were generated via a CA on our domain. IE, and Chrome work transparently, firefox used to. I know get a "This Connection is Untrusted" page in firefox.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;www.facebook.com uses an invalid security certificate. The certificate is not trusted because the issuer certificate is unknown. (Error code: sec_error_unknown_issuer)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It seems that firefox isnt recognizing our CA for some reason. Hopefully someone else has seen this behavior. &l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;IE &amp;amp; Chrome use the Windows certificate store&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Firefox has its own&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You need to export your decryption root CA (the one you marked as Forward Trust Certificate)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;and import it to the Firefox Trusted Root CA Store.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Marco&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hello Depps,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;As Marco has stated, IE &amp;amp; Chrome share the same cert repository, while Firefox utilizes it's own. You will need to manually import the cert into Firefox via the Certificate Manager as a Trusted Authority, then Trust the CA to identify websites when prompted: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;IMG alt="ff.JPG.jpg" class="jive-image" src="https://live.paloaltonetworks.com/legacyfs/online/11959_ff.JPG.jpg" style="width: 620px; height: 396px;"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Bryan&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
